Shot on 8mm film in 1969, this vintage home movie captures a sun-drenched drive through the Bahamas. The camera moves steadily along a freeway, offering views of low-rise buildings, palm trees, and classic American cars from the era. The footage features a distinct purple-tinted color grade, characteristic of 1960s film stock, with visible grain and slight motion blur. Streetlights, utility poles, and a distant communications tower punctuate the landscape under a bright, cloudy sky.
